BURSCOUGH

SD41SW MERSCAR LANE 663-1/2/17 (North side) Nos.2 AND 4

II

Pair of cottages. Dated 1819 at 1st floor; altered and enlarged to rear. Brown brick in Flemish bond, slate roof. Double-depth, No.2 to the right single-fronted and No.4 double-fronted. Two low storeys, 2+1 windows; No.2 has the doorway to the left and No.4 has the doorway in the centre, both with wedge lintels and now protected by gabled wooden porches; both have 2-light casement windows with raised sills and large wedge lintels, those at No.2 wider and all with altered glazing. Datestone above doorway of No.4, inscribed: W J + E 1819 Ridge chimney at junction, and gable chimneys.
